Beijing Becomes Regional Headquarters for 11 Multi-national Corporations

Eleven multi-national corporations which have their regional headquarters located in Beijing will get more preferential policies in the future.

The Beijing Foreign Trade and Economic Cooperation Commission has issued certificates to the 11 transnational corporations, including IBM, Samsung, Nortel Networks, Compaq, and Lucent Technologies, to confirm their establishment of regional headquarters in Beijing.

The 11 companies were expected to get preferential treatment including breaks in tax deduction, market access, foreign exchange management, and transfer of personnel.

Beijing Vice Mayor Zhang Mao said that Beijing, as well as the rest of the country, has accelerated internationalization of local foreign trade as China's entry into the World Trade Organization (WTO) approaches.

Statistics show that Beijing had approved over 15,000 foreign- funded businesses with contracted foreign capital of US$ 28.7 billion by the end of May, 2000.

Over 150 of the World Top 500 firms have invested in Beijing.
